The Artists

Amelia Wise is currently in her second year at the Royal Academy of Music, studying clarinet with Sonia Sielaff and bass clarinet with Laurent Slimane. Previously she has studied with Richard Russell, Anna Hashimoto and Claire King. She has also been on two summer courses in Belgium with Annelien Van Wauwe and two masterclasses with David Campbell.

Amelia has previously competed in the final of Bath Young Musician twice and won the Thelma King instrumental award at the Mid-Somerset Festival in 2023. She loves orchestral playing and is part of the University of London Symphony Orchestra where she primarily plays bass clarinet.

She recently performed the Rite of Spring with the Royal Academy Symphony Orchestra and performed a successful recital at Sevenoaks Music Club for which she was selected following the Sevenoaks Young Musician competition. Amelia also enjoys playing the bass clarinet with Claritas Clarinet Quartet.
